DO NOT USE!!!

They do not care about you.
They do not care about fairness or a promise of goods in exchange , the app is a lie and the company is a scam.

Do not send your books, they LIE. They say it is on a bad condition, or not received, or has mold on it when it clearly did not.
I have had them accept 8-10p books but not £3+ ones were strangely 'not received' - in the same box?

The final straw was when i sent a book 'worth' £5.94, it was in EXCELLENT condition and they said it was water damaged. they would not budge even though i pleaded and also told them i spent over £20 buying books from them that very week. I lost the book and the money- they said as soon as it is sent to them it is there property and they can do what they want with it.

When i tried to fight for my consumer rights they said 'Also, kindly note that, once we have received your items, ownership of the items passes immediately and irrevocably to us.'

When we trade with them the app promised ease and trust, it is then not delivered. We expect fairness and an exchange, and tine and time again they have proved they do not do this.

DO NOT USE!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!

Also, bought books from them that are in AWFUL condition, pages ripped out, bent - pointless waste of time.

When play scripts are normally £10-16 RRP, and can be read within an hour or two, the costs can start to stack up. So I love that Wob has such a wide collection to choose from, for only a few pounds each. They also have some great otherwise out-of-print scripts! I've always found the company to be pretty efficient in their dispatch and use of Royal Mail 48 delivery (which is free for orders over £5).

They rectified an incomplete delivery address on a recent order with a replacement without any quibbles.

The only slight disappointment is the endless loop the chatbot can send you in on their website. AI is no replacement for customer service! However they have real people manning their Instagram, and the real person was very helpful!

Always loved world of books and purchased a few used books from them but recently I bought 2 ology series books and was going to buy another vampireology one but they rose the price from €30 to €80. Just because the other ones were bought from me they thought the demand is high. I was about to purchase last night until I noticed the price increase.

They do the same with the Martha Stewart books too change the price based on if its popular or not. Set it to one price and leave it at that if you want loyal customers as people do notice.
